What Should Parents Consider When Choosing the Best Kids Crossbow?
When choosing the best kids crossbow, parents should consider various factors to ensure safety, usability, and enjoyment for their children.
- Safety Features: It’s crucial to select a crossbow that includes safety mechanisms, such as finger guards and anti-dry fire systems. These features help prevent accidents and ensure that the child can handle the crossbow responsibly.
- Draw Weight: The draw weight indicates how much force is needed to pull back the string. For younger children or beginners, a lower draw weight (typically between 10-20 pounds) is advisable, as it allows for easier handling and shooting without causing strain.
- Size and Weight: The crossbow should be appropriately sized for the child’s age and strength. A lightweight and compact design will make it easier for kids to maneuver and shoot accurately, enhancing their overall experience.
- Durability: Kids can be rough on equipment, so selecting a crossbow made from durable materials is essential. Look for models with robust plastic or composite frames that can withstand drops and rough handling.
- Ease of Use: A user-friendly design with simple assembly and operation will help kids learn how to use the crossbow more effectively. Features like easy-to-load bolts and intuitive sights can enhance the learning experience.
- Targeting System: A good targeting system will aid in accuracy, making shooting more enjoyable. Look for crossbows with adjustable sights or red dot scopes that help kids aim better.
- Price and Warranty: Finally, consider the price point and available warranty. It’s wise to find a balance between affordability and quality, and a warranty can provide peace of mind against defects or issues.
How Does Age Affect the Type of Crossbow Suitable for Kids?
The age of a child significantly influences the choice of crossbow suitable for them.
- Age 5-8: Lightweight and Low Draw Weight Crossbows – At this age, children are still developing their strength and coordination, so crossbows that are lightweight and have a low draw weight (around 10-20 pounds) are ideal. These crossbows allow for easier handling and help prevent strain or injury as kids learn the basics of archery.
- Age 9-12: Adjustable Draw Weight Crossbows – Children in this age range can handle slightly more power, so crossbows with adjustable draw weights (between 20-30 pounds) are suitable. This adaptability allows the crossbow to grow with the child’s developing skills and strength, providing a longer period of use without needing to purchase new equipment frequently.
- Age 13 and Up: Higher Performance Crossbows – Teenagers can handle more sophisticated and higher performance crossbows, typically with draw weights ranging from 30-50 pounds. These crossbows offer improved accuracy and range, allowing older children and teens to engage in more competitive archery activities while fostering their skills.
- Safety Features Across All Ages – Regardless of age, it is crucial that all crossbows have safety features such as finger guards, anti-dry fire mechanisms, and proper instruction manuals. These features help prevent accidents and ensure that children understand the importance of safety while handling archery equipment.
What Safety Features Are Essential in Kids Crossbows?
When selecting a kids crossbow, prioritizing safety features is essential for ensuring a secure and enjoyable experience. Here are key safety features to consider:
-
Automatic Safety Mechanism: Look for models that include an automatic safety system that engages when the crossbow is cocked. This prevents accidental firing and adds a layer of protection.
-
Anti-Dry Fire Technology: This feature prevents the crossbow from being fired without an arrow loaded, reducing the risk of injury from a dry fire.
-
Finger Guards: Crossbows equipped with finger guards help protect little fingers from being placed in the path of the string, which can cause serious injuries.
-
Adjustable Stock and Foregrip: An adjustable design ensures that the crossbow fits properly in the hands of growing children, promoting better control and aiming capabilities.
-
Safety Lock: A manual safety lock allows for extra precaution, ensuring the crossbow cannot be fired unless intentionally set to shoot.
-
Durable Construction: Lightweight yet durable materials reduce the risk of damage and enhance safety during play, especially if the crossbow is dropped or mishandled.
These features enhance the overall safety of kids’ crossbows and help parents feel more confident in their children’s archery experience.

What Safety Guidelines Should Be Followed When Kids Use Crossbows?
When kids use crossbows, it is essential to follow specific safety guidelines to ensure their protection and proper handling of the equipment.
- Adult Supervision: Always ensure that a responsible adult is present when kids are using a crossbow.
- Proper Training: Kids should receive thorough training on how to operate a crossbow safely before using one.
- Use of Safety Gear: It’s vital to wear appropriate safety gear, including eye protection and gloves, to minimize the risk of injury.
- Understanding the Range: Kids must be taught to recognize the safe shooting range and understand the importance of identifying their target and what lies beyond it.
- Crossbow Maintenance: Regular maintenance of the crossbow is crucial to ensure it operates safely and effectively, including checking the string and limbs for wear.
- Avoiding Movement: Teach kids to remain still and calm while handling the crossbow, avoiding sudden movements that could lead to accidents.
- Storage Practices: Crossbows should be stored in a secure location, out of reach of children when not in use, to prevent unauthorized handling.
Adult supervision is critical as it provides guidance and immediate intervention in case of unsafe behavior, ensuring that kids understand the seriousness of using a crossbow. Proper training allows kids to familiarize themselves with the mechanics and safety features of the crossbow, helping to instill confidence and competence in their usage.
Wearing safety gear, such as eye protection and gloves, minimizes the risk of injury from accidents or misfires, ensuring that kids can enjoy the sport without unnecessary risk. Understanding the shooting range helps to instill a sense of responsibility in kids, teaching them to always be aware of their surroundings and the importance of safe practices in archery.
Regular maintenance of the crossbow is essential to prevent malfunctions that could lead to accidents; ensuring that the equipment is in good condition helps reinforce safe usage habits. Teaching kids to avoid sudden movements while handling the crossbow helps prevent accidental discharges and promotes a calm and focused approach to using the equipment.
Finally, proper storage practices are crucial to keep the crossbow out of reach when not in use, preventing unauthorized handling and potential accidents, thus ensuring that safety remains a priority even when the crossbow is not being actively used.
How Can Parents Ensure a Safe and Enjoyable Experience for Their Children While Crossbow Shooting?
To ensure a safe and enjoyable experience for children while crossbow shooting, parents should consider several key factors:
- Choose the Right Crossbow: Select a crossbow that is specifically designed for children, taking into account their age, size, and strength. The best kids crossbows are lightweight and have lower draw weights, making them easier to handle and shoot accurately.
- Teach Safety Protocols: Before allowing children to shoot, it is crucial to educate them about safety rules, such as always pointing the crossbow in a safe direction and keeping fingers away from the trigger until ready to shoot. Reinforcing these safety protocols instills responsible habits that can last a lifetime.
- Supervised Shooting Sessions: Always supervise children during shooting sessions to ensure they are following safety rules and to provide guidance. Adult supervision can help prevent accidents and also enhance the learning experience by allowing parents to offer tips and encouragement.
- Use Proper Protective Gear: Equip children with appropriate safety gear, including eye protection and arm guards, to prevent injuries. This protective equipment is essential in promoting a safe shooting environment and helps children feel more secure while practicing their skills.
- Start with Basic Techniques: Begin teaching children the fundamentals of shooting, such as proper stance, grip, and aiming techniques. Focusing on basic techniques not only improves their skills but also builds their confidence as they become more proficient in handling the crossbow.
- Set Up a Safe Shooting Range: Ensure that the shooting area is safe and appropriate for children, with a proper backstop to catch arrows and no nearby distractions or hazards. A controlled environment minimizes risks and allows children to focus on their shooting without unnecessary interruptions.
- Encourage Fun and Patience: Make the experience enjoyable by incorporating games or challenges that motivate children to practice without feeling pressured. Encouraging a fun atmosphere helps children develop a positive attitude towards shooting and fosters a lasting interest in the sport.
